Есть форма ввода логин/пароль и кнопка рядом, примерно с таким кодом:

Код:
on(release){
var cmd:String = "user_verify";
var login:String = logpass.txt_login.text;
var password:String = logpass.txt_password.text;
getURL("https://stat.url.ru/cgi-bin/utm/aaa", "_self", "POST");
}
Кнопка работает нормально, однако когда я ставлю этот же код в событие "change" текстового поля "пароль" после отлавливания нажатия "Enter", переменные не отсылаются, ЧТО ДЕЛАТЬ???
Код текстового поля:

Код:
on (change) {
var keyListener:Object = new Object();
keyListener.onKeyDown = function() {
if (Key.isDown(Key.ENTER)) {
var login:String = _root.login_enter.logpass.txt_login.text;
var password:String = _root.login_enter.logpass.txt_password.text;
GetURL("https://stat.url.ru/cgi-bin/utm/aaa", "_self", "POST");
}
};
Key.addListener(keyListener);
}